This tutorial will explain about Bootstrap Datatable with Add, edit and remove record. Here we will use a simple Bootstrap Modal Popup to create add and edit form. Few months back, we have published an article on Bootstrap with php, mysl server side script. Based on the previous article of Bootstrap datatable, we are going to create a simple datatable with add, edit and remove options.
We using the code odoo 12 development cookbook pdf free download the last article and change.
For Add and edit, we use below Bootstrap Popup Modal. Then place an add button to the upper right corner, which is going to open the add modal window. The new entry form will save the data via jQuery and then add the new row to the table. After that, we need to write some PHP:. Next step is to edit the current rows. We placed an edit button to the end of each row. When the user clicks on this button, the editRow id will be called:.
Now we can add new entries and edit the existing ones. But what if we need to remove an entry? The answer is easy: create a remove function! Next to the edit buttons, create a remove button which is going to call the removeRow id function:. So we continued the previous article and extended it. Now we are able to create new entries, edit the existing ones or remove them.
Live Demo Download Source Code. Laravel 5. Display Browser Web Push Notification in web application. Join Discussdesk for latest updates. Follow us. Share on Facebook Share. Share on Twitter Tweet. Share on Google Plus Share. Latest news. What are the basic functional units of a computer system?
The dark mode beta is finally here. Change your preferences any time.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. I'm using BootstrapTable plugin. I want to dynamically add and remove some rows. My problem is that every time when I add a new row, type some characters in inputs and then remove some of rows all data is lost. What I'm doing wrong?
Example and fiddle at the bottom. And refresh the table and data on server when you delete rows.
Learn more. BootstrapTable - dynamically add and delete row Ask Question. Asked 5 years, 1 month ago. Active 2 years, 5 months ago. Viewed 10k times. Active Oldest Votes. Max Lipsky Max Lipsky 1, 14 14 silver badges 25 25 bronze badges. I had hope that there is a parameter in the plugin to do this and I will not have to code it by myself.
This worked for me. Took me the whole day to figure this out.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password. Post as a guest Name. Email Required, but never shown. The Overflow Blog. Podcast Cryptocurrency-Based Life Forms.
ASP.NET page using Jquery datatables with Edit/Delete feature
The dark mode beta is finally here. Change your preferences any time.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. I'm using BootstrapTable plugin. I want to dynamically add and remove some rows. My problem is that every time when I add a new row, type some characters in inputs and then remove some of rows all data is lost. What I'm doing wrong? Example and fiddle at the bottom.
And refresh the table and data on server when you delete rows. Learn more. BootstrapTable - dynamically add and delete row Ask Question. Asked 5 years, 2 months ago. Active 2 years, 6 months ago. Viewed 10k times. Active Oldest Votes. Max Lipsky Max Lipsky 1, 14 14 silver badges 25 25 bronze badges. I had hope that there is a parameter in the plugin to do this and I will not have to code it by myself. This worked for me. Took me the whole day to figure this out. Sign up or log in Sign up using Google.Datatables are widely used in many industries and by many people.
Students use datatable for simpler tasks like organizing the data and visualizing the results. Professionals in marketing and data management do more complex tasks like combining two fields, visualizing the results from tons of tables and finding new solutions through the data.
Whether you are making a simple datatable or a complex datatable with different functions, there is a design for you in this bootstrap datatable example collection. While designing a bootstrap datatable, make basic things clear. Whether you are going to make a regular vertical scroll table or a horizontal scroll table.
Make a note on what are all the functions the user is going to expect from your table. If your field is going to have a lot of data related to a particular data, then make sure whether you need a single modal window or a multi-modal window. Functionalities for the rows and the columns, plus, decide whether you need a resizable column and rows.
Another design factor which we have to decide is how we are going to differentiate the rows; most commonly used methods are zebra stripes, line divisions, and free from without any boundaries. In this bootstrap datatable list we have taken care of the look and the design so that you can concentrate more on the functionalities. Experts always recommend moving from smaller elements to bigger ones when making a complex element.
After taking a complete list of all the functions you need and characteristics of each and every cell on the datatable, move towards the design.
Make a rough sketch before moving on to the original design. Designer Slava Shestopalov has given a detailed insight on designing a complex web tabletake a look at it for more design related tips. Adminator is primarily a dashboard template with lots of element pre-designed for you.
Subscribe to RSS
In this template, you get a data table and also interactive charts to visualize the data. This bootstrap datatable has all the basic functions like searching, sorting, adjusting the display density. Right below the table, you have pagination to let the user easily jump to the table page they want.
Throughout the template, the designer has maintained a professional look. If you like to have a unique pagination design for your table, take a look at our CSS pagination design collection. All features given in this datatable are functional, hence you can concentrate on the customization part. In the previous Adminator datatable, I said you can use the chart separately to visualize the content. But in this datatable, the creator has given you a pie chart as one of the columns in the datatable.
At a glance, the user can see the performance of a particular item on the table. You can also select a particular row and can export it.
Along with the export option, you also have the option to include and exclude a column with a single click. Different viewing options are also given in this datatable, which most users will love to use. Overall it is a perfect bootstrap datatable with all the basics been done properly. The SRTDash gives us three datatable design. The functionality of all three tables remain the same, there are only a few cosmetic changes. All the tables have a fixed header design, sorting option arrows are placed right next to the header labels.
At the top right corner, you have a dropdown option to control the display density, i. If the user has to deal with multiple rows, they can easily increase the display density and scan the data quickly. Based on the design you like, pick one and start working on it to make your custom datatable.Below, I have given all those scripts. Design the HTML table. In the below code, as you can see, I have assigned an id to the table and its body.
Before moving to the next step, please be sure that your table is in a proper format. Go to code behind of the page to create a function which will return the data to bind the table. I have created a class UserList with five auto-implemented properties, as you can see in the below code. Write the code inside the head section of. Step 6 Now, define the CallMe function of jQuery and assign one parameter which will get the button id to perform the operation.
Write the code to perform any operation on the id. Shreesh Raj Updated date, Nov 02 In order to implement the jQuery Datatable, follow the below mentioned steps. I used UserId property to define all the rows uniquely. Now, each button has onclick event with its respective id parameter.
If I will click on any button, the CallMe function will get executed and the respective id parameter will be passed. Inside the CallMe function, we can identify which button is clicked by its id and we can perform any operation, like update, delete etc.Looking for a ASP. NET C example of the following:. This should be flexible enough to handle any dataset of many rows and variation of columns.
See more: asp net page jquery accordion keep openjquery display asp net page popupasp net page inside pageasp net mvc edit table rowmvc 5 inline editeditable grid in mvc 4asp. Dear Sir, I am writing in response to your project posting for a job. After carefully reviewing the experience requirements of the job description, I feel that I am a suitable match for the job. I've been working More. I have read details.
I see that you need a page which can utilize datatables on the page. Whereas it should provide edit and delete features on rows as normal.
We are experienced devs from Ukraine, willing to help you with your small project Relevant Skills and Experience. I understand you want a jquery-ajax based table which will fetch data from asmx service. Hello, I have very good hands on Jquery datatables. As I have implemented filter at the top as in web site demo also I have enable disabled filtering at column level as well so user can filter any col Relevant Skills More.
Hello, I go through your requirement and found that you are looking to ingrate web service data with jquery tables with operations. I have worked in web service and jqxgrid that is similar grid. Relevant Skills and Ex More.
HelloHope you are doing good. This is Ramesh. We have 12 years of experience in website development, software development and Mobile Application development in different technologies. I have gone through you More. I have done this type of work before for our client please send me message for further conversation. Thanks Relevant Skills and Ex More. I am writing to express my interest in ASP.By default, when using inline editing, Editor will submit only the value of the field that has been edited with no Ajax submission happening if the value has not changed.
This behaviour is controlled by the form-options object that is passed into the inline method, or the formOptions. This example demonstrates the allIfChanged option, which can be useful if you need to perform calculations on the server-side based on information in the row, regardless of which field value was altered. The effect of this parameter can be observed in the Submitted data section of the Ajax data tab below the table where you will see the full data for a row after editing a field.
The latest data that has been loaded is shown below. This data will update automatically as any additional data is loaded. The script used to perform the server-side processing for this table is shown below.
Editing options - submit full row data By default, when using inline editing, Editor will submit only the value of the field that has been edited with no Ajax submission happening if the value has not changed.
Add, Edit, Delete Operations on DataTable in C#
If none have changed, nothing will be submitted all - Submit all field values, even if there are no changes. Inline editing Simple inline editing Tab between columns Editing options - submit on blur Editing options - submit full row data Inline editing with a submit button Edit icon Joined tables Responsive integration Selected columns only FixedColumns integration Server-side processing. Bubble editing Simple bubble editing Multiple fields in a bubble Form control and display options Default control and display options Bubble editing with in table row controls.